Peta Boucher Marriage and Family Practicum Intern/ LCDC-I

MS, MFT intern, LCDC-I, Life Coach, and Meditation Practitioner

CREDENTIALS/QUALIFICATIONS

  • MS, in Marriage and Family Therapy, Capella University (Current Practicum Intern)
  • Licensed Chemical Dependency Counselor Intern
  • Certified Shamanic Life Coach
  • Certified Meditation Practioner
  • BS, in Psychology, Texas A & M- Central Texas (2018)
  • AA, Multidisciplinary Studies, Grantham University

PERSONAL BACKGROUND

EricaPetagaye Boucher is known professionally as Peta Boucher. She and her husband are both retired from the United States Army. Peta has served a substantial amount of time in her military career at Fort Hood and served the Central Texas area for many years. In spare time Peta enjoys garden, Outreach, making music, and arts and craft projects with her children.

PROFESSIONAL BACKGROUND

Peta served as a Platoon Sergeant in the United States Army and is a Retired Army Veteran. Given her time as an investigator with the Department of Family and Protective Services (DFPS), she is familiar with the local area and the services available to those within the community. Peta’s experience has assisted her in her ability to maintain a balance of objectivity and empathy for families. Peta is also a traditional healer and has serviced several young mothers in central Texas as their Doula. Peta is receiving her MS in Marriage and Family Therapy at Capella University where she is a member of Psi Chi International Honor Society and the National Society of Leadership and Success. Her specialties include Solution Focused Therapy, Bowen’s Theory of Human Behavior, Family Systems, Ancestral Healing, Intergenerational, Trans-Generational Trauma, Ancestral Trauma, and meditation. Her approach to therapy draws from the solution-focused, intergenerational, cognitive behavioral, rational emotive, and mindfulness models. Peta’s approach is eclectic and dependent on your individual needs. She is very tech-savvy, open to tele-mental health, and responds quickly to text or email. Peta’s military expertise and background in protective services allow her to work well with a diverse population and respect cultural diversity among clients.
